What a “$100 No-Deposit Crypto Bonus” Actually Means

In the current regulatory environment, platforms like BTCC and others offer what is known as a “Stacked Reward” system. Rather than handing out free cash to speculators, these incentives are designed to reward users for learning and practicing platform mechanics safely.

A typical $100 reward stack is usually distributed across these stages:

  • Account Setup & Verification: $10–$20 in instant trial credits or trading vouchers just for completing KYC.

  • Educational Milestones: $20–$40 for finishing basic trading quizzes or platform tutorials.

  • Active Trading Unlocks: The remaining $40–$50 is typically unlocked as fee rebates or margin credits once you initiate trading activity.
